marsden_online: (Blueknight)
So I was having some problems with defragging C drive.There were these few really large files which just couldn't defrag, because little green system files were in the way of creating enough space.

I still haven't found a way of moving the system files, but I did download WinDirStat, a marvelous visual tool for showing you what files take up how much space on your drive. Lo, the big troublesome files were all Picasa cache files - one was over a Gig in size.

"C'mere, Picasa," said I. "I want to have a word about your settings".

Under interrogation Picasa revealed a "Clear the Cache" option which was duly exercised to remove the offending files. "Now Picasa" I said, "how about keeping that cache somewhere different? I've plenty of space on these other drives."
"I'm sorry," replied Picasa, "I can't do that."

So I asked the internet, which unfortunately agreed with Picasa. The curse of the Windows profile directory strikes again. Next reinstall I put that somewhere else from the word go - I'm not quite willing to risk moving it on an established system right now, although I have successfully done so in the past.
